MySQL中大数据表如何增加字段
发表于:2025-12-01 作者:千家信息网编辑
千家信息网最后更新 2025年12月01日,这篇文章将为大家详细讲解有关MySQL中大数据表如何增加字段,小编觉得挺实用的,因此分享给大家做个参考,希望大家阅读完这篇文章后可以有所收获。前言增加字段相信大家应该都不陌生,随手就可以写出来,给 M
千家信息网最后更新 2025年12月01日MySQL中大数据表如何增加字段
这篇文章将为大家详细讲解有关MySQL中大数据表如何增加字段,小编觉得挺实用的,因此分享给大家做个参考,希望大家阅读完这篇文章后可以有所收获。
前言
增加字段相信大家应该都不陌生,随手就可以写出来,给 MySQL 一张表加字段执行如下 sql 就可以了:
ALTER TABLE tbl_tpl ADD title(255) DEFAULT '' COMMENT '标题' AFTER id;
但是线上的一张表如果数据量很大呢,执行加字段操作就会锁表,这个过程可能需要很长时间甚至导致服务崩溃,那么这样操作就很有风险了。
给 MySQL 大表加字段的思路
① 创建一个临时的新表,首先复制旧表的结构(包含索引)
create table new_table like old_table;
② 给新表加上新增的字段
③ 把旧表的数据复制过来
insert into new_table(filed1,filed2…) select filed1,filed2,… from old_table
④ 删除旧表,重命名新表的名字为旧表的名字
不过这里需要注意,执行第三步的时候,可能这个过程也需要时间,这个时候有新的数据进来,所以原来的表如果有字段记录了数据的写入时间就最好了,可以找到执行这一步操作之后的数据,并重复导入到新表,直到数据差异很小。不过还是会可能损失极少量的数据。
所以,如果表的数据特别大,同时又要保证数据完整,最好停机操作。
另外的方法
在从库进行加字段操作,然后主从切换
使用第三方在线改字段的工具
一般情况下,十几万的数据量,可以直接进行加字段操作。
关于"MySQL中大数据表如何增加字段"这篇文章就分享到这里了,希望以上内容可以对大家有一定的帮助,使各位可以学到更多知识,如果觉得文章不错,请把它分享出去让更多的人看到。
数据
字段
篇文章
数据表
中大
名字
时候
时间
更多
最好
过程
不错
实用
很大
陌生
主从
内容
前言
同时
工具
数据库的安全要保护哪些东西
数据库安全各自的含义是什么
生产安全数据库录入
数据库的安全性及管理
数据库安全策略包含哪些
海淀数据库安全审计系统
建立农村房屋安全信息数据库
易用的数据库客户端支持安全管理
连接数据库失败ssl安全错误
数据库的锁怎样保障安全
新乡两年制计算机网络技术专业
程序员需要学习网络安全吗
网络安全视频设计
自制壁纸软件开发
win7装2008数据库
华为服务器raid10
山西通用软件开发联系方式
云食尚分拣软件开发
proc程序连接数据库方式
建朗信息科技是互联网企业吗
灵山奇缘哪个服务器
浦东新区定制软件开发诚信服务
如何把github搭建成服务器
默纳克服务器调试完如何退出
开展网络安全教育活动简报
专业人员网络安全教育知识
我的世界什么是数据库
青海网络安全技能大赛
网络安全重大会议活动保障
连锁餐饮管理软件开发
软件开发的生命周期5个阶段
阿里云腾讯云百度云服务器哪个好
常见网络安全问题原因分析
外网ftp服务器安全吗
安徽机架式服务器报价
张家口行为管理服务器厂家
网络技术是啥意思
金蝶客户端需要安装数据库吗
爱迪森网络技术服务公司
网络技术教学的主要内容